Singer Alsou and her husband Yan Abramov are preparing to divide their property after filing for divorce. The list of what the couple has includes two mansions and two apartments.
The couple bought their first property immediately after the wedding – an apartment on Leningradskoye Shosse in Moscow on the 57th floor of an elite residential complex.
Two years later, the Abramovs got a four-story house on Rublyovka. The singer did not hide her Victorian-style mansion in the village of Usovo and was regularly photographed among the columns, stucco moldings and sculptures. Custom-made furniture, mosaics on the walls, a swimming pool with panoramic windows and a view of the pine forest – in general, nothing special, a typical three thousand square meter house for those parts.
Alsou’s father gave another cottage, on the Crimean coast, to his grandchildren. The estate is located in the village of Orlovka, near Sevastopol. On the territory there is a private beach, a pier, a stable, a tennis court, a helipad and even its own mosque.
Besides all this wealth, the Abramovs have an apartment in London next to the Lord's Cricket Ground on St John's Wood where the most important cricket matches are held. And Alsou personally owns a Maybach 62.
